Where does “సవ్యము” come from?
సవ్యము (Telugu) comes from Sanskrit सव्य, from Proto-Indo-Iranian sawyás, from Proto-Indo-European sewyós — left, left-hand.
సవ్యము (Telugu): Of or pertaining to left
Ancestry of “సవ్యము”, step by step
| Step | Language | Word | Meaning |
|---|
| 1 | Sanskrit | सव्य | left, left-hand; the left arm or hand |
| 2 | Proto-Indo-Iranian | sawyás | left, left-hand |
| 3 | Proto-Indo-European | sewyós | left, left-hand |
